Whenever I quit Internet Explorer I get the following
error message:

DDE Server Window: iexplore.exe

The instruction at "0x01f72008" referenced memory
at "0x01f72008". The memory could not be "read".

This is a fairly new occurence. I'm running Internet
Explorer 6SP on Windows XP. Can anyone help or let me
know what's going on.

[WE HAVE A WINNER!]

1. Disable your anti-virus application.

2. Leave it off while you go to Windows Update and get Q818529 (at least).

3. Reboot when instructed.

4. See problem disappear.

5. If not, uninstall Yahoo Companion (Toolbar).
